When you're looking for somehing new to revive your palate after all that holiday eating, try @seafoodfromnorway_us's receipt for Norwegian Salmon with Hot Honey Glaze. Link in bio to shop ingredients

What you'll need:
1 - 8 ounce Norwegian salmon fillet, skinned, deboned and divided into two 4 ounce fillets
½ teaspoon kosher salt
¼ teaspoon ground coriander
½ teaspoon smoked paprika
¼ teaspoon fresh cracked pepper
¼ cup honey
½ teaspoon sambal
1 tablespoon sliced red or green chilies

What you'll do:
1. In a heavy bottom sauce pan over medium high heat, add honey, sambal and chilies. Simmer for about 10 minutes. Remove pan from the heat and set aside. The longer the honey sits the more flavor the chilies release.
2. In the meantime, pat salmon dry and season with salt, coriander, smoked paprika and fresh cracked pepper.
3. Add oil to a cast iron skillet over medium high heat. Once the oil is hot, add salmon to the pan, presentation side down.
4. Cook the salmon for four minutes; flip and cook for another three minutes. Top salmon with glaze while in pan, to coat each filet.
5. Transfer to serving plates, top with more chili sauce, serve with brussels sprouts or your favorite vegetable, if desired.

Craving a Bloody Mary this #DryJanuary? Make it a Craving a Bloody Mary this #DryJanuary? Make it a Virgin Mary! 🍅🌶️

What you'll need:
3 stalks of celery
2 tsp horseradish
1 tsp chopped shallot
dash Worcestershire sauce
1 tsp celery salt
1 tsp kosher salt
12 dashes hot sauce
2 juices limes
48oz tomato juice

What you'll do:
Cut the celery in large dice, including the leaves, and puree. Add the horseradish, shallot, Worcestershire sauce, celery salt, kosher salt, hot sauce and lime juice and process until smooth. Pour mixture into a large pitcher, add tomato juice, stir and serve!
